Cuzco vs Priest River, Id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Cuzco, Peru and Priest River, Id, Usa is approximately 8,172 km or 5,078 mi.
  • To reach Cuzco in this distance one would set out from Priest River, Id bearing 134.2°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Cuzco bearing 150.6° or SSE .
  • Cuzco has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Priest River, Id has a warm, dry summer continental/ hemiboreal climate (Dsb).
  •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 5.2 °C (9.4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 18.3 °C (32.9°F) less in Cuzco.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 61.3 mm (2.4 in) less which is equivalent to 61.3 l/m² (1.5 US gal/ft²) or 613,000 l/ha (65,534 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 29.8° higher in Cuzco than in Priest River, Id.
